I was invited down to the Make Media Now conference to give a talk about Open Source Cinema. Fun times! I ran into some friends and did some bowling with Lance Weiler of The WorkBook Project. Now, Lance is an OK bowler (although), but a much better self-distributor. Lance has had a lot of success DIY releasing whis last two feature films, Head Trauma, and The Last Broadcast.
He was able to turn a profit and keep rights on these projects by pioneering some innovate theatrical distribution techniques, and now he is sharing this knowledge at The WorkBookProject, which is an open source filmmakers handbook. Lots of great information in there, and he's opening the book for other contributions.
